Tekelerde İki Farklı Sulandırıcı ile Sulandırılan Spermaya Değişik Oranlarda Bal İlavesinin Kısa Süreli Saklamaya Etkisi
Çalışmada, yağsız süt ve Tris-yumurta sarısı sulandırıcıları ile sulandırılan teke spermasına farklıoranlarda bal ilavesinin kısa süreli saklamada spermatolojik özelliklere ve yaşam süresine etkisiincelendi. Sperma 2 ergin tekeden elektroejakulatör ile haftada 2 kez alındı ve + 4-6 °C’desaklanan sperma örnekleri 12 saat aralıklarla değerlendirildi. Motilite, süt kontrol grubunda 24. saatve 60. saat arasında bal içeren gruplardan, Tris kontrol grubunda ise 48. saate kadar bal içerengruplardan yüksek bulundu. Hipo osmotic swelling (HOS) test değeri, süt kontrol grubunda 12.ve 24. saatlerde %2.5 ve %5 bal ilaveli gruplardan yüksek, %1 bal ilaveli grup ile benzer, 36 ve 60.saatler arasında kontrol grubu bal ilaveli gruplardan yüksekti. HOS test değerleri, Tris kontrolgrubunda 48. saate kadar yüksek, 60. saatte %1 bal ilaveli gruba benzerdi. Anormal spermatozoonoranı, Tris kontrol grubunda 48. saate kadar %1 bal içeren gruptan, 48. saatte ise % 1 ve 5 balilaveli gruptan düşük bulundu. Ölü/canlı spermatozoon oranı, süt kontrol grubunda 0. saatte %5 balilaveli gruptan, 12. saatte %2.5 ve %5 bal ilaveli gruptan, 24. saat ile 72. saatler arasında ise balilaveli tüm gruplardan düşük, Tris kontrol grubu 60. saate kadar bal ilaveli gruplardan, 72. saatte isesadece %5 bal ilaveli gruptan düşük bulundu.Sonuç olarak, teke spermasının kısa süreli saklanmasında, Tris ve süt sulandırıcılı kontrolgruplarının spermatolojik kalite ve yaşam süresi bakımından deneme gruplarına göre daha iyiolduğu, gruplar arası değerlendirmede Tris sulandırıcısının üstün olduğu ve sulandırıcılara balilavelerinin spermatolojik özelliklerde herhangi bir ilerleme sağlamadığı saptandı.
Effect of Different Rates of Honey Supplementation on Short Term Storage Semen Diluted with Two Different Diluents in Male Goats
In theise study, the effect of addition of honey at different ratios to goat semen diluted with skim milk and tris+egg yolk extenders on spermatological characteristics and lifespan during short term storage was investigated. The semen samples stored at 4-6°C. The motility between 24th and 60th hour in milk control group and up to 48th hour in tris control group was found higher than all honey groups. The HOS test value was similar in milk control with 1% honey group and was higher than other groups at 12nd and 24th hour. Between 36th and 60th hour, the control was higher than other groups. The HOS test values were high in tris control group up to 48th hour than all honey groups but similar to 1% honey group at 60th hour. The abnormal spermatozoon ratio in Tris control was lower than 1% honey group until 48th, 1% and 5% honey group at 48th hour. The dead/live spermatozoon ratio was lower in the milk control than in 5% honey group at 0st, 2.5% and 5% honey group at 12nd, between 24th and 72nd hour all trial groups. Tris control was lower than other groups up to 60th, only 5% honey group at 72nd hour. As a result, the control groups of tris and milk extenders were better than trial groups during short term storage with regard to spermatological quality and lifespan. It was concluded that tris extender was superior considering the intergroup comparisons and honey didn’t provide any improvement in the spermatological features.
